R studio 문법(2)

2021. 5. 7. 00:54R 공부/R

일단 패키지 개념에 대해 알아보고 가겠습니다.

패키지 = 함수 꾸러미라고 할수있습니다.

여러가지 패키지가 있으므로 자신이 필요한 기능들이 들어

있는 패키지를 찾아보고

패키지를 다운받아서 사용하면 됩니다.

install.packages("ggplot2")
library(ggplot2)
qplot(data = mpg, x = hwy)

가장 흔하고 연습용으로 많이 사용되는 ggplot2 를 사용해볼게요!

첫번째 line으로 ggplo2를 설치하구요.

두번째 line으로 library를 불러옵니다.

그리고 ggplot2안에 있는 qplot함수를 사용해볼게요

qplot(data = 자신이 분석할 데이터, x = x축에 나타낼 지표)를 입력해줄게요!

참고로 mpg 데이터는 ggolot2안에 있는 기본 데이터입니다.

실행을 하게 되면

 

실행결과

실행 결과 이런 그래프가 그려지게 됩니다. 아 참고로 hwy는 고속도로 연비 지표 입니다.

 

다른 예를 해봅시다.

qplot(data = mpg, y = hwy, x = drv, geom = "point")

data에는 mpg를 넣고 y축에는 hwy(고속도로 연비), x축에는 drv(drive모드) 을 넣어줍니다.

geom은 그래프의 모양을 결정해주는 파라미터 입니다. point 즉 점으로 표현해라 라고 합니다.

결과

그럼 다음과 같은 그래프가 그려지게 됩니다.

그럼 점이 아닌 다른그래프를 그리고 싶으면?

qplot(data = mpg, y = hwy, x = drv, geom = "boxplot")

geom의 값을 바꿔주면 됩니다. boxplot이라는 모양으로 바꿔줄게요!

결과

다음과 같은 그래프가 그려지게 됩니다.

그리고 box에 색을 넣고 싶다면?

qplot(data = mpg, y = hwy, x = drv, geom = "boxplot",colour = drv)

colur파라미터에 색깔을 넣을 축의 변수를 넣어줍니다. 

결과

이러한 그래프가 그려지게 됩니다.

package안에 있는 함수의 정보를 알고 싶다면?

?qlot

이 line을 실행시켜보면 함수를 어떻게 사용하는지 가르쳐줍니다. example도 있으니 참고하시면 좋을거 같아요.

 

화이팅 다들 열심히 공부합시다!

'R 공부 > R' 카테고리의 다른 글

데이터 전처리(1)  (0) 2021.05.17
데이터 파악 및 수정  (0) 2021.05.16
데이터 프레임  (0) 2021.05.16
R 의 기본 문법(1)  (0) 2021.05.07
R이 무엇인가요?  (0) 2021.04.25